在数字化时代,网站已经成为企业和个人展示形象、拓展业务的重要平台。从源码入门到独立搭建网站,不仅需要掌握一定的技术知识,还需要了解高效的建设流程。本文将为您揭秘高效网站建设流程,帮助您从零开始,逐步搭建属于自己的网站。
一、源码入门:掌握基础技术
1. HTML:网页的骨架
HTML(HyperText Markup Language)是网页制作的基础,它定义了网页的结构和内容。学习HTML,您需要掌握以下内容:
- 基本的标签使用
- 布局技巧,如表格、框架、浮动布局等
- 表单制作与交互
- 响应式设计
2. CSS:网页的样式
CSS(Cascading Style Sheets)用于美化网页,控制网页元素的样式。学习CSS,您需要掌握以下内容:
- 选择器、属性、值
- 布局技巧,如定位、浮动、盒子模型等
- 响应式设计
- 常用框架,如Bootstrap
3. JavaScript:网页的动态效果
JavaScript是一种客户端脚本语言,用于实现网页的动态效果。学习JavaScript,您需要掌握以下内容:
- 基本语法、变量、数据类型
- 函数、对象、数组
- 事件处理
- 常用库和框架,如jQuery、Vue.js
二、选择合适的开发工具
1. 编辑器:提高开发效率
选择一款合适的代码编辑器可以提高开发效率。常见的代码编辑器有:
- Sublime Text
- Visual Studio Code
- Atom
2. 版本控制:团队协作
版本控制工具可以帮助您管理代码,实现团队协作。常用的版本控制工具有:
- Git
- SVN
三、网站建设流程
1. 需求分析
在开始建设网站之前,首先要明确网站的目标、功能、受众等需求。这包括:
- 网站定位:企业、个人、组织等
- 目标受众:年龄、性别、地域等
- 功能需求:展示、交互、购物、论坛等
- 设计风格:简洁、大气、时尚等
2. 网站设计
根据需求分析,进行网站的整体设计。这包括:
- 网站结构:页面布局、导航、内容等
- 网站风格:颜色、字体、图片等
- 网站图标:logo、图标等
3. 网站开发
根据设计稿,进行网站的前端和后端开发。这包括:
- 前端开发:HTML、CSS、JavaScript等
- 后端开发:服务器、数据库、编程语言等
4. 网站测试
在网站开发完成后,进行全面的测试,确保网站的功能和性能。这包括:
- 功能测试:验证网站功能是否正常
- 性能测试:测试网站加载速度、响应时间等
- 安全测试:检查网站是否存在漏洞
5. 网站上线
将测试通过的网站部署到服务器,使其正式上线。这包括:
- 服务器选择:云服务器、虚拟主机等
- 域名注册:购买合适的域名
- 网站备案:遵守国家相关法规
6. 网站维护
网站上线后,需要定期进行维护,以保证网站的正常运行。这包括:
- 数据备份:定期备份网站数据
- 网站更新:更新网站内容、功能等
- 安全防护:防止黑客攻击、病毒感染等
四、总结
从源码入门到独立搭建网站,需要掌握一定的技术知识,了解高效的建设流程。通过本文的介绍,相信您已经对网站建设有了更深入的了解。希望您能够将所学知识应用于实践,搭建出属于自己的网站。
